And she tries to be, duly swallowing every pill her friends, family and doctors recommend, but she can\u2019t help feeling down: Martin\u2019s return has brought back her long-suppressed depression, which soon pushes her to hurt not just herself but those around her. When after a long sleep on a new antidepressant she finds her husband stabbed to death, she can\u2019t seem to remember a thing.
